For the 2025-26 school year, there are 4 private schools serving 276 students in Westchester, IL (there are , serving 1,063 public students). 21% of all K-12 students in Westchester, IL are educated in private schools (compared to the IL state average of 12%).
50% of private schools in Westchester, IL are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Christian).
